LOS ANGELES–Six media agencies are competing for Boston Beer’s estimated $30 million media buying and planning account, according to sources.

The sextet includes the New York offices of Publicis’ Zenith Media; Aegis’ Carat; IPG’s Initiative Media; independent Media First; and WPP media networks The Media Edge and MindShare. The marketer of Samuel Adams beer, sources also said, will visit contender offices next week.

The incumbent, Grey’s MediaCom, New York, a division of Grey Global Group, resigned the business after it picked up Diageo’s beer and spirits business, which includes Guinness beer.
